The web is so infinite with websites on every subject known to man…but just when I thought I had seen everything I discovered www.MizPee.com, a website dedicated to finding a clean place to do your business.
Just type in the address where you are at and a list of nearby restrooms appear, with cleanliness ratings, hours [...]

Ourexplorer.com is another Travel 2.0 website, which uses the internet to make our ever-shrinking world smaller. The website matches local expert tour guides with eager-to-learn tourists…the concept is so refreshingly simple that it is surprising that no one has thought of it before.
The twist is that anyone can sign-up as a tour guide and name their price…so [...]

When flying, a few extra inches in a seat’s width or pitch make a huge difference…..especially for those flying in storage coach. Although every airline is quick to boast how their seat is the best, Seatguru.com has the actual facts and figures neatly organized in a handy comparison chart.
After you’ve figured out what airline will have the [...]

Whatsonwhen.com is like a master datebook for the world. When planning a trip, you can find out what is happening at your destination based on the dates you will be there and what type of even you are looking for. Event genres range from “classical music,” to “sports & outdoors,” to ”weird & wonderful.”
